RISPERIDONE
Risperidone is an atypical antipsychotic antagonizing dopamine and serotonin receptors. Used in schizophrenia, bipolar disorder, and autismrelated irritability. Datasheet
| Molecular Formula | C23H27FN4O2 |
|---|---|
| Molecular Weight | 410.5 g/mol |
| CAS Number | 106266-06-2 |
| Storage Condition | Risperdal Tablets should be stored at controlled room temperature 15 deg – 25 °C (59 deg -77 °F). Protect from light and moisture. Risperdal 1 mg/mL Oral Solution should be stored at controlled room temperature 15 deg – 25 °C (59 deg – 77 °F). Protect from light and freezing. Risperdal M-TAB Orally Disintegrating Tablets should be stored at controlled room temperature 15 deg – 25 °C (59 deg – 77 °F). |
| Solubility | Solubility depends on solvent and conditions (e.g., pH). Please contact us for solvent-specific guidance. |
| Purity | Purity information is available upon request (COA). |
| Synonym | risperidone; 106266-06-2; Risperdal; Risperdal Consta; Rispolept |
| IUPAC/Chemical Name | 3-[2-[4-(6-fluoro-1,2-benzoxazol-3-yl)piperidin-1-yl]ethyl]-2-methyl-6,7,8,9-tetrahydropyrido[1,2-a]pyrimidin-4-one |
| InChl Key | RAPZEAPATHNIPO-UHFFFAOYSA-N |
| InChl Code | InChI=1S/C23H27FN4O2/c1-15-18(23(29)28-10-3-2-4-21(28)25-15)9-13-27-11-7-16(8-12-27)22-19-6-5-17(24)14-20(19)30-26-22/h5-6,14,16H,2-4,7-13H2,1H3 |
